How to Master the Technique at Home
Ready to bring that restaurant secret home? Try these tips:
- Choose fresh, plump scallops—frozen or dried scallops miss the crunch.
- Dry scallops thoroughly before patting with flour and seasoning.
- Use a light batter (egg wash mixed with cornstarch works well) for crispiness without sogginess.
- Cook on high heat for 2–3 minutes per side until golden brown and firm.
